This is also misleading. The survey question was not whether the treaty should "feature" in news stories but whether it "applied" to journalism. Most respondents said the treaty was relevant to news stories "in which the treaty is referenced", not just news stories generally, as is stated here.
Some of the information in this book excerpt is either distorted or flat out wrong. According to the survey, 58% of journalists are women, not "two out of every three". The average journalist is 45.8 years old, and they are not "mostly aged in their 20s or 30s" newsroom.co.nz/2025/11/24/j...
